Question
Consider the following statements with respect to
Preamble of the Constitution of India: 1. The Preamble is based on the 'Objective Resolution' moved by Jawaharlal Nehru in the Constitution Assembly. 2. The Preamble has been amended only twice so far. 3. In the Berubari Union case (1960), Supreme Court held that Preamble is a part of the Constitution. Which of the statements given above is/are correct?Solution
The Preamble to the Indian Constitution is based on the ‘Objectives Resolution’, drafted and moved by Pandit Nehru, and adopted by the Constituent Assembly. Hence statement 1 is correct.  • The Supreme Court held that the basic elements or the fundamental features of the Constitution as contained in the Preamble cannot be altered by an amendment under Article 368. The Preamble has been amended only once so far, in 1976, by the 42nd Constitutional Amendment Act, which has added three new words–Socialist, Secular and Integrity–to the Preamble. This amendment was held to be valid. Hence statement 2 is not correct. In the Berubari Union case (1960), the Supreme Court said that the Preamble shows the general purposes behind the several provisions in the Constitution, and is thus a key to the minds of the makers of the Constitution. Despite this recognition of the significance of the Preamble, the Supreme Court specifically opined that Preamble is not a part of the Constitution. Hence statement 3 is not correct.
